Aristolochic acid mutational signature defines the low-risk subtype in upper tract urothelial carcinoma
Rationale: Dietary exposure to aristolochic acids and similar compounds (collectively, AA) is a significant risk factor for nephropathy and subsequent upper tract urothelial carcinoma (UTUC).
